Rwanda is a beautiful country in the central africa. The capital city is Kigali. As i approched the airport i could see small houses from the air . The drive form the airport to the city is not so pleasant. I spent the night a Chezlando hotel which costs about 40USD.............. The next three days i spend them touring the country, i went to nyanza.....The land of the king, Here i visited the kings palace. Nyungwe rain forest is awesome, there is a waterfall and the birds singing is memorable, i also had a chance to see the columbus monkey. I visited lake kivu and spent the night in a town called gisenyi. on coming back i went up the virunga mountain to see the Gorillas. The primates are big and very friendly........as long as you dont scare them with flash lights from your cameras........ Visiting kigali cannot be complete without visiting the Genocide memorial. The visit to the memorial made me realsise that we need more love and peace for each other to make a better world. Rwanda should be visited by anyone with love for culture.
